>>>>> But I strongly think that it it good to have IP+port hashing, for
>>>>> cases
>>>>>
>>>>> where multiple clients run on single host, in this case
>>>>>> the connections have same IP but different port. In this case also the
>>>>>> same
>>>>>> is desirable,i.e same client to the same real-server.
>>>>>> This may not make a real use case for web world, but a strong case for
>>>>>> non-web deployments like in telecom.I know LVS is increasingly used in
>>>>>> other than web services.
>>>>>>
>>>>>>
>>>>>> What should be the use case for this? Source ports are almost always
>>>>> choosen randomly, so you woould get the same results as balancing
>>>>> randomly.
>>>>>
>>>>>
>>>>> Not necessarily,I came across few implementations where client port is
>>>> fixed (they bind() port while creating socket), but I agree that most of
>>>>
>>>>
>>> Sure.
>>>
>>>
>>> the times source port is random.
>>>
>>>> The good approach would be LVS to provide options for IP+port or just
>>>> IP
>>>> hashing.
>>>>
>>>>
>>> But I still miss the use case. If the client always does come with the
>>> same port, it doesn't make a difference if the port is used too for
>>> hashing
>>> or just the IP.
>>>
>>>
>> Oh..Sorry, I should have been clear.
>> Here is the use case: I have a client (from out side it looks like a piza
>> box, but internally it has many CPU..something like blade server/ATCA)
>> which initiates TCP/SCTP connections with same IP address but with
>> different Port.
>> So if I use SH, all these connections (potentially this client can
>> initiate
>> as many as 40 connections) will land on a same real server which may not
>> be
>> what we wanted. we wanted the connections to be balanced (based on
>> IP+port)
>> across all the real servers. Does it make sense?
>>
>
> Hmm, if it comes to a few thousand different ports, it would, but not for
> 40 (imho). ;)
